The Significance of RTP in Slot Game Development
The RTP metric has long served as a benchmark for evaluating slot machines’ payout potential. For developers, balancing RTP is both a regulatory requirement and a strategic tool: too high, and margins suffer; too low, and players perceive the game as unfair. Modern slots incorporate RTP as a central component of their design philosophy, using data to craft experiences that are both enticing and financially sustainable.
The Evolution Towards Higher RTP Slots
Historically, slot RTPs hovered around 85-90%. However, industry trends indicate a movement towards higher RTP titles to attract discerning players seeking transparency and greater winning opportunities. This shift is evident in the proliferation of games boasting RTPs exceeding 96%, reflecting the industry’s response to increasing competition and the demand for player-centric experiences.
